Commit Diff


commit - dccb68cbf18a5c37081c79ae6168daac4c60d882
commit + c46b93520a1536b30c3ccaf95007c9d74ad4c20e
blob - 4f289f3a0cacea3b4a2f4656e89e3a5c3679e090
blob + a39d6b3eba1f29d911941a345e5b23bd9c747ab8
--- tog/tog.c
+++ tog/tog.c
@@ -974,11 +974,11 @@ show_diff_view(struct got_object *obj1, struct got_obj
 				break;
 			case 'k':
 			case KEY_UP:
-			case KEY_BACKSPACE:
 				if (first_displayed_line > 1)
 					first_displayed_line--;
 				break;
 			case KEY_PPAGE:
+			case KEY_BACKSPACE:
 				i = 0;
 				while (i++ < LINES - 1 &&
 				    first_displayed_line > 1)